Products used (Also, I have a super oily t-zone)
Prep & Prime: Mehron Skin Prep Pro , Nurturing Force Blot Out Offensive Cream, Minimize Pores and Primer Water
Foundation: Can't Stop Won't Stop in Mocha x NYX (they have like 40+ shades)
Eyeliner: Liquid Liner in Black Out x Morphe
Lashes: some 3D ones from the beauty supply; they were like $3
Eyeshadow (bottom lash line): any dark brown shadow will do. I used one from the 350M palette x Morphe (sold exclusively at Ulta)
Mascara (bottom lash): Better Than Sex x Too Faced
Concealer: Toffee x LA Girl Pro (I go between Fawn and Toffee)
Finishing Powder: 362 Fit Me Matte + Poreless x Maybelline
